WP version is 2.8.4
Atahualpa 3.4.1


Hello,

I have noticed that my BFA subscribe widget is not working properly. Namely:

1. It does not send any emails to subscribed users (though blog is updated daily)
2. After registering for email subscription (top field of the plugin) and confirming it, the new subscribed is NOT added to the Subscribers list under Tools section of the blog admin panel menu (this could irrelevant, I am not sure)
3. However, when I try to subscribe again with the same email - it says that user with this email is already subscribed (via feedburner).

Could you advise me how to amend the situation? - I want my email subscription working.
Thank you
